What Makes a Power Bank Suitable for the Note 8?
A power bank suitable for the Note 8 should meet several key specifications to ensure compatibility and efficiency:
| Specification | Recommendation |
|---|---|
| Capacity | At least 3000mAh (Note 8 has a 3300mAh battery) |
| Output Voltage | 5V |
| Output Current | At least 2A |
| Compatibility | Supports Qualcomm Quick Charge 2.0 or 3.0 |
| Port Type | USB Type-C or micro USB |
| Size and Weight | Portable design for ease of carrying |
| Charging Speed | Fast charging capability recommended |
| Safety Features | Overcharge protection and temperature control |

How Do Power Bank Capacity and Output Influence Charging Efficiency?
Power bank capacity and output significantly influence charging efficiency. Larger capacity allows for more energy storage, while higher output rates enable faster charging.
-
Capacity: The capacity of a power bank is measured in milliamp-hours (mAh). A larger capacity means the power bank can store more energy. For instance, a power bank with 20,000 mAh can charge devices multiple times compared to a 10,000 mAh power bank. This is particularly important for devices with high power needs, like tablets or laptops.
-
Output: The output is measured in amperes (A) or watts (W). Power banks with higher output provide more energy to the device quickly. For example, a power bank with a 2.4A output charges devices faster than one with a 1A output. Devices will benefit from a high output as they will charge quickly, reducing wait time for users.
-
Charging efficiency: Not all energy stored in a power bank reaches the device. Charging efficiency usually ranges from 70% to 90%, depending on the power bank design and quality. A study in the Journal of Power Sources (Smith, 2020) showed that efficient circuitry can improve energy transfer significantly. The combination of capacity and output affects this efficiency. If the capacity is high but the output is low, the charging time will be longer, reducing overall effectiveness.
-
Compatibility: Device compatibility also plays a role. Devices require specific voltage levels to charge efficiently. A power bank providing a consistent output that matches the device’s requirements will optimize charging performance. For example, modern smartphones often support rapid charging, which requires a compatible power bank to take advantage of faster charging speeds.
-

What Safety Features Should Be Mandatory in Power Banks for the Note 8?
The mandatory safety features for power banks intended for the Samsung Note 8 should include circuit protection, temperature control, overcharging protection, and Short Circuit protection.
- Circuit Protection
- Temperature Control
- Overcharging Protection
- Short Circuit Protection
To understand these features better, we can delve into each one.
-
Circuit Protection:
Circuit protection refers to mechanisms that prevent the overcurrent that can damage the device. This feature safeguards both the power bank and the smartphone from electrical damage. According to a 2021 study by Battery University, circuit protection significantly reduces the risk of battery failure. -
Temperature Control:
Temperature control involves monitoring the heat generated during charging. This feature activates cooling mechanisms or shuts down the device if it becomes too hot. The Consumer Electronics Association (CEA) emphasizes that managing temperature enhances battery longevity and prevents thermal runaway, a dangerous condition that can cause fires. -
Overcharging Protection:
Overcharging protection stops the battery from receiving power once it reaches full charge. This feature prevents battery swelling or leakage. A report from the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) indicates that overcharging can reduce battery life by 30% if not managed properly. -
Short Circuit Protection:
Short circuit protection detects faults in the circuitry and disconnects power to prevent damage. This feature is crucial because short circuits can lead to fires. A 2020 analysis by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) linked many electrical device fires to inadequate short circuit protection.
